Baltimore Orioles at New York Yankees Free Pick 09/22/18

The Baltimore Orioles will play their divisional rival New York Yankees at Yankee Stadium. The matchup will begin at 4:05 p.m. ET and fans can tune in to Mid-Atlantic Sports Network to catch the action.

Baltimore Orioles vs. New York Yankees Odds

Oddsmakers have listed Baltimore (+255) as the underdog to New York (-305). Bettors can wager on the game’s total with odds sitting at -110 for over 9.5 runs and -110 for under 9.5. Bettors can also wager on the game’s spread with the most recent runline odds sitting at Orioles +1.5 runs (+125) and Yankees -1.5 runs (-145).

The Yankees are 94-59 straight up (SU) and 74-78 against the spread (ATS). The team’s lost 11.3 units for bettors taking the moneyline and 14.1 units (ATS). New York has covered the spread only twice in its last seven games and the total has gone over in four of those seven. The Orioles are 44-109 SU and have gone 62-90 ATS. Overall, the team’s lost 53.8 units for moneyline bettors and 41.6 units ATS. Baltimore is 3-4 ATS over its last seven games and the under has hit in four of those seven.

Yankees games have a 69-76-7 over/under record in 2018. The Orioles have also been a decent under bet with a total record of 68-79-5.

David Hess will get the nod for the visiting Orioles. The right-handed Hess is 3-10 with a 5.22 ERA and 65 strikeouts. He has yet to face the Yankees this year and did not record a start against them in 2017, either.

The Yankees are handing the ball to righty Lance Lynn (9-10, 4.90 ERA), who has 153 strikeouts and 73 walks to his name, as well as a WHIP of 1.53. Lynn is 1-0 with eight strikeouts and a 0.87 ERA in one start against Baltimore this year.

Baltimore’s pitchers have allowed 5.5 runs per game and its starters own a 5.51 ERA, 1.50 WHIP and 7.16 K/9. The bullpen has logged an ERA of 4.76, along with a K-per-9 of 8.19.

Orioles hitters have slashed .239/.299/.391 on their way to 3.8 runs scored per game in 2018, including 4.3 runs per game against divisional foes and 4.4 per game over the team’s last five contests (2-3 SU).

Outfielders Adam Jones and Trey Mancini have paced Baltimore’s hitters. Jones is slashing .284/.314/.424 with 15 home runs, 60 RBIs and 53 runs scored, while Mancini is hitting .240 with 23 homers, 53 RBIs and 64 runs scored.

In the other dugout, New York’s pitching staff has allowed 4.1 runs per game overall in 2018. The club’s starters have an ERA of 4.05, a WHIP of 1.25 and a strikeouts-per-nine of 9.2. The bullpen has a 3.38 ERA, 1.21 WHIP and 11.3 K/9. In 67 divisional games, Yankees starters have an ERA of 4.07 and the bullpen’s ERA is 3.48.

New York’s offense is putting up 5.2 runs per outing, including 5.3 per game against divisional foes and 6.2 per game over its last five. The team has hit .233/.337/.459 over its last five contests and is 3-2 SU during that stretch.

Miguel Andujar and Giancarlo Stanton have led the Yankees’ batters this year. Andujar is slashing .295/.329/.520 with 25 home runs, 84 RBIs and 78 runs scored, while Stanton’s line is .262/.338/.497 with 35 homers, 93 RBIs and 94 runs scored.

The Orioles have lost 47.5 units and are 39-64 ATS when facing a righty starter this season. The over has hit in 47 of those games, compared to 52 that’ve gone under against right-handed starting pitchers. On the other hand, the Yankees have lost 13.2 units and are 55-53 ATS when facing a righty starter. The over’s cashed in 50 of those games, compared to 55 that went under.
